Marine Ship Launch Airbags for Launching, Lifting and Dry Docking

Marine ship launch airbags are inflatable rubber products used for vessel launching, dry docking, lifting, and moving heavy marine structures. Compared with fixed slipways or conventional launching methods, ship launching airbags offer a more flexible and cost-effective solution for small and medium shipyards, temporary launching sites, and maintenance operations. They help reduce infrastructure requirements while allowing vessels to be launched or repositioned with controlled support.

Structure drawing of marine ship launch airbag with airbag mouths, body section, cone ends and reinforced layers

Structure Notes:

A and B: Airbag mouths / metal end fittings
C: Airbag end section, cone shape
D: Airbag diameter
E: Airbag body section, cylindrical shape
F: Reinforced rubber and fabric layer structure
L: Total length
L1: Effective length

Ship Launch Airbag Structure and Selection Notes

A ship launch airbag consists of a cylindrical airbag body, cone-shaped end sections, reinforced rubber layers, synthetic tire-cord fabric layers, and metal end fittings. The reinforced body is formed and vulcanized to provide flexibility, bearing capacity, and durability during vessel launching, lifting, and moving operations.

Airbag mouths are installed at both ends for inflation and air release. The end fittings can be manufactured from carbon steel or stainless steel according to project requirements. Airbag diameter, effective length, total length, layer quantity, and working pressure should be selected according to vessel data, launching conditions, and site requirements.

Typical Selection Factors

Selection Factor Description
Vessel Weight Used to estimate the required airbag quantity, bearing capacity, and working pressure.
Hull Shape Affects the contact area between the hull and the airbags during launching or lifting.
Launching Slope Helps determine the airbag layout, rolling direction, and operation method.
Ground Condition Flatness, hardness, and surface condition should be checked before airbag operation.
Airbag Diameter Selected according to vessel clearance, lifting height, hull support area, and site arrangement.
Effective Length Selected according to hull width, contact area, and launching arrangement.
Layer Quantity Designed according to required bearing capacity and working pressure.
Working Pressure Confirmed according to airbag size, layer structure, vessel weight, and operation requirements.

Final airbag selection should be confirmed according to vessel weight, hull shape, launching site conditions, airbag layout, and safety requirements.

Ship launch airbags are made with durable rubber layers and reinforced synthetic tire-cord fabric layers. The airbag body is formed and vulcanized to provide flexibility, bearing capacity, and durability for vessel launching and lifting operations.

Yes. Ship launch airbags can be reused when they are properly operated, inspected, stored, and maintained. Actual service life depends on working pressure, ground condition, vessel load, operation method, and storage environment.
